Monument to F.M. Dostoevsky in Kharkiv

The sculpture of Fyodor Mikhailovich Dostoevsky, the outstanding Russian writer and thinker, is located in the famous Kharkiv Sculpture Garden, right in the courtyard of the "Hermitage" restaurant. The idea of creating the garden belongs to the restaurant owner, Vladimir Chepel. The first monuments appeared here in the autumn of 2011, and in 2013, the collection was decided to be expanded with new sculptures. At that time, figures of Leo Tolstoy, Fyodor Dostoevsky, Pyotr Stolypin, and Vasily Shukshin were installed here. Since then, the exhibition has been constantly replenished with new works.

The sculpture of Dostoevsky harmoniously fits with the architecture of the garden. It is made of bronze and depicts the writer in full height, dressed in an open coat, with his hands in his pockets. His thoughtful gaze is directed into the unknown, as if he is pondering over another mystical work.

Although the sculpture of Dostoevsky was installed after the garden's opening, it has successfully integrated into the overall ensemble. Now visitors can come to the Sculpture Garden, stand next to their favorite writer, or touch his bronze hand for good luck.
